"Dark Shadows" Movie Review


Barnabas Collins is a vampire cursed by a witch who is in love and, unfortunately for him, Barnabas does not return her love. He is left in a casket for more than a century and when released, he finds that he has landed in the year 1972. Johnny Depp can play almost any role that is thrown his way. A pirate, a hatter, and a vampire. The latter is shown here and it is interesting and amusing to see him play a vampire from the 1700s. Tim Burton's macabre and creepy humor comes out throughout, with Johnny Depp definitely helping with that. It is also considerably dark and while trying to maintain the comedy over the course of almost two hours, the movie has its ups and down. The sexual content is a bit much as well and would have been perfectly fine without it. However, I enjoyed it because you develop feelings for the characters and it certainly does grab you and make you want to learn how it all turns out. "Dark Shadows" is also a perfect Halloween movie.

7/10
